## Deployment

The Wavelet Preview service renders audio waveform thumbnails for the Chorusline upload pipeline. Deploy it behind the internal gateway only; it assumes trusted callers and performs no authentication of its own. Future maintainers should rebuild the render cache after any codec library upgrade. The deployment expects the following configuration values to be present at startup.

deployment values, fahap-hahaf:
[casdor]
port = 9200
region = south-2
host = casdor.qirvanworks.corp
timeout_ms = 3000
retries = 4

## Deployment

Welcome to Fanfare, our notification fan-out service. The main thing to know: downstream push providers are slow and moody, so we apply backpressure aggressively rather than queueing forever. When the buffer fills, we shed low-priority notifications first (digest emails, basically). Deploys are rolling, two pods at a time, and the shed thresholds are loaded at boot — no hot reload yet, sorry. If you're tuning anything, start from the defaults and change one knob at a time. Current production values follow.

service settings:
PRAIX_LOG_LEVEL=error
PRAIX_METRICS_HOST=metrics.praix.qorvelcorp.corp
PRAIX_POOL_SIZE=16

Fan-out backpressure for the Quillet notifier: when the queue depth crosses the soft limit, the dispatcher sheds low-priority pushes and batches the rest at 500ms intervals. Reviewer should confirm the shed counter is exported and that retries respect the jitter window. Once merged, the release artifact gets re-signed by the pipeline, which expects the deploy key shown below.

deploy key for bawep-yawif: bky6_GQhaSt